Unveiling the Stihl MS 500i: A Deep Dive into Price and Performance

Before we get into the nitty-gritty of pricing, let’s understand what makes the Stihl MS 500i such a sought-after piece of equipment. I remember when I first saw one in action – a seasoned logger effortlessly felling a massive oak, the saw seemingly gliding through the wood. It was a sight to behold.

The MS 500i stands out due to its:

  • Electronic Fuel Injection (EFI): This is the game-changer. EFI optimizes fuel delivery for consistent power, improved fuel efficiency, and easier starting, regardless of temperature or altitude.
  • Lightweight Design: Despite its power, the 500i is surprisingly light, reducing fatigue during long working hours.
  • High Torque and Acceleration: It boasts impressive torque, allowing it to handle demanding cutting tasks with ease.
  • Optimized Engine Management: This system ensures optimal performance and protects the engine from damage.

The Price Tag: What to Expect

Okay, let’s address the elephant in the room: the price. The Stihl MS 500i typically ranges from $1,600 to $1,900 USD for the powerhead alone. This price can fluctuate based on location, dealer promotions, and the included bar and chain length.

Factors Influencing the Price

  • Dealer Location: Prices can vary significantly between dealers, especially in areas with high demand.
  • Promotional Offers: Keep an eye out for seasonal sales or package deals that might include extra chains, bars, or safety gear.
  • Used Market: While buying used can save money, it’s crucial to inspect the saw thoroughly and ensure it’s in good working condition.
  • Bar and Chain Length: Longer bars and higher-quality chains will increase the overall cost.

Alternatives to the Stihl MS 500i

If the MS 500i is beyond your budget, don’t despair! There are plenty of excellent alternatives available.

  • Stihl MS 462 R C-M: A powerful and reliable saw that offers excellent performance at a lower price point.
  • Husqvarna 572 XP: A comparable option from Husqvarna, known for its durability and cutting speed.
  • Stihl MS 362 C-M: A versatile saw that’s suitable for a wide range of tasks, from felling small trees to bucking firewood.

Key Consideration: When choosing an alternative, consider the engine size, weight, and power output to ensure it meets your specific needs.

1. Sharpen Your Chain Like a Pro

A sharp chain is the single most important factor in efficient wood processing. A dull chain not only slows you down but also puts unnecessary strain on your saw and increases the risk of kickback.

The Problem: Dull chains cause the saw to “bounce” or “chatter” instead of cutting smoothly. They also produce fine sawdust instead of clean chips, indicating that the chain is rubbing rather than cutting.

The Solution: Invest in a quality chain sharpening kit and learn how to use it properly. I recommend using a round file and a depth gauge to maintain the correct cutting angles and depth limiter settings.

2. Master the Art of Felling

Felling a tree safely and efficiently is a crucial skill for anyone involved in wood processing. A poorly felled tree can damage property, injure workers, or waste valuable timber.

The Problem: Incorrect felling techniques can lead to “barber chairing” (splitting the tree trunk), uncontrolled falls, and damage to surrounding trees.

The Solution: Learn the proper felling techniques, including:

  • Assessing the Tree: Evaluate the tree’s lean, wind direction, and any defects (e.g., rot, cracks).
  • Planning the Escape Route: Clear a path away from the tree at a 45-degree angle.
  • Making the Notch: Cut a notch on the side of the tree in the direction you want it to fall. The notch should be about 1/3 of the tree’s diameter.
  • Making the Back Cut: Cut the back cut slightly above the notch, leaving a hinge of uncut wood to control the fall.
  • Using Felling Wedges: If the tree is leaning in the wrong direction, use felling wedges to help guide its fall.

3. Optimize Bucking Techniques

Bucking is the process of cutting felled trees into manageable lengths for firewood or other purposes. Efficient bucking techniques can save you time and effort while maximizing the yield from each tree.

The Problem: Inefficient bucking can lead to wasted wood, uneven lengths, and unnecessary strain on your back.

The Solution:

  • Plan Your Cuts: Before you start cutting, plan the lengths you need and mark them on the log.
  • Use a Bucking Sawhorse: A sawhorse will elevate the log, making it easier to cut and reducing strain on your back.
  • Support the Log: Use wedges or other supports to prevent the log from pinching the saw blade.
  • Use the Correct Cutting Technique: For small logs, you can cut straight through. For larger logs, use a “step cut” or “bore cut” to prevent pinching.

4. Choose the Right Wood Species for Your Needs

Not all wood is created equal. Different wood species have different properties that make them suitable for different purposes.

The Problem: Using the wrong wood species for a particular application can lead to premature failure, reduced efficiency, or safety hazards.

The Solution:

  • Firewood: For firewood, choose dense hardwoods like oak, maple, and hickory. These woods burn longer and produce more heat.
  • Construction: For construction, choose strong and durable woods like Douglas fir, pine, and cedar.
  • Furniture: For furniture, choose hardwoods with attractive grain patterns like cherry, walnut, and mahogany.

Unique Insight: The moisture content of wood significantly affects its burning properties. Seasoned firewood (dried for at least six months) burns much more efficiently and produces less smoke than green wood.

5. Invest in Quality Safety Gear

Safety should always be your top priority when working with chainsaws and processing wood. Accidents can happen quickly and have serious consequences.

The Problem: A lack of proper safety gear can increase the risk of injury from kickback, falling debris, or other hazards.

The Solution:

  • Wear a Helmet: A helmet will protect your head from falling branches and debris.
  • Wear Eye Protection: Safety glasses or a face shield will protect your eyes from sawdust and flying chips.
  • Wear Hearing Protection: Earplugs or earmuffs will protect your hearing from the loud noise of the chainsaw.
  • Wear Gloves: Gloves will protect your hands from cuts and abrasions.
  • Wear Chainsaw Chaps: Chaps will protect your legs from chainsaw cuts.
  • Wear Steel-Toed Boots: Boots will protect your feet from falling logs and other hazards.

6. Maintain Your Equipment Regularly

Regular maintenance is essential for keeping your chainsaw and other wood processing equipment in good working condition. Proper maintenance will extend the life of your equipment, improve its performance, and reduce the risk of accidents.

The Problem: Neglecting maintenance can lead to equipment failures, reduced efficiency, and increased repair costs.

The Solution:

  • Clean Your Chainsaw Regularly: Remove sawdust and debris from the engine, air filter, and bar.
  • Check the Chain Tension: Adjust the chain tension as needed to prevent it from binding or derailing.
  • Sharpen the Chain Regularly: A sharp chain is essential for efficient cutting and safety.
  • Check the Fuel and Oil Levels: Keep the fuel and oil tanks filled to the proper levels.
  • Replace Worn Parts: Replace worn parts like spark plugs, air filters, and fuel lines as needed.

Actionable Takeaway: Create a maintenance schedule for your equipment and stick to it. This will help you catch potential problems before they become serious.

7. Master the Art of Splitting Wood Efficiently

Splitting wood is a necessary task for anyone who uses firewood for heating or cooking. Efficient splitting techniques can save you time and effort while reducing the risk of injury.

The Problem: Improper splitting techniques can lead to wasted energy, back pain, and potential injuries.

The Solution:

  • Use a Wood Splitter: A hydraulic wood splitter is the most efficient way to split large quantities of wood.
  • Use a Splitting Maul: A splitting maul is a heavy, wedge-shaped axe that’s designed for splitting wood.
  • Use a Splitting Wedge: A splitting wedge can be used to split particularly tough or knotty logs.
  • Choose the Right Technique: For straight-grained logs, you can split them down the middle. For knotty logs, try splitting them around the knots.
  • Maintain Proper Posture: Keep your back straight and bend your knees when lifting and swinging the maul.
